Brentwood Borough Council is looking for a committed and knowledgeable Arboricultural Officer to help manage, enhance, and protect the borough’s diverse tree stock across parks, open spaces, woodlands, housing assets, and conservation sites.

If you’re passionate about trees, enjoy working outdoors in varied landscapes, and can provide expert Arboricultural advice, this role offers a fantastic opportunity to make a meaningful impact on the local environment and community.

As our Arboricultural Officer, you will:

  • Carry out detailed tree inspections using VTI, QTRA, PTI and other recognised methodologies.
  • Manage and update the Council’s digital Tree Management System, including surveying, mapping and programming risk-based works.
  • Provide professional advice on tree management, TPOs, Conservation Area notifications, and planning applications.
  • Produce reports, assess risks, and create work programmes for trees across parks, open spaces, car parks and housing sites.
  • Manage and monitor external contractors, ensuring compliance with RAMS, insurance and quality standards.
  • Support enforcement of arboricultural conditions, high hedge legislation, and root damage investigations.
  • Assist with woodland management and delivery of grant-funded environmental projects.
  • Engage with residents, stakeholders and councillors, attending site meetings and responding to enquiries.

You will bring:

  • Strong experience in arboriculture, including tree surveying, TPO regulations and BS3998.
  • Proven experience working with contractors and managing work programmes.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ft applications and tree management software.
  • Excellent communication, diplomacy and customer service skills.
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ment with changing priorities.
  • Diagnostic skills in tree health, pests and diseases.

Essential qualifications include:

  • Lantra VTI (or equivalent).
  • RFS Diploma in Arboriculture (or equivalent).
  • Full driving licence and access to own vehicle.
  • Lantra PTI – or willingness to work towards.
  • QTRA – or willingness to work towards.
  • IOSH Managing Safely – or willingness to work towards.
